  • Page 6 Structural Fasteners - Not Supplied (continued) Non-Seismic Wall Fastener Guidelines NOTICE Anchors should be rated for a minimum of 300 lb of tension/withdrawl. Lag screws require pilot holes. • If the wall is wood stud-and-drywall construction, 1/4" minimum lag screws into every stud is acceptable (24"...
  • Page 7 Structural Fasteners - Not Supplied (continued) Non-Seismic Wall Fastener Guidelines (continued) • If the wall is metal stud-and-drywall construction, 1/4" minimum SnapToggle BB type anchors and bolts into ® every stud is acceptable (24" O.C. maximum spacing). https://toggler.com/ https://toggler.com/...
  • Page 8 Structural Fasteners - Not Supplied (continued) Non-Seismic Wall Fastener Guidelines (continued) • If the wall is concrete block (CMU) construction (hollow), 1/4" minimum Tapcon hex HD concrete screws ® (1/4" X 1-3/4" minimum), spaced no more than 16" apart is acceptable� NOTICE Never use a hammer function when drilling into hollow concrete masonry units (CMU).
  • Page 9 Structural Fasteners - Not Supplied (continued) Non-Seismic Wall Fastener Guidelines (continued) • If the wall is concrete block (CMU) construction (core filled), 1/4" minimum Tapcon hex HD concrete screws ® (1/4" x 1-3/4" minimum), spaced no more than 16" apart is acceptable� •...

  • Page 52: Care And Maintenance

    Care and Maintenance • Clean the locker and its components with a mild detergent. Avoid using harsh or abrasive cleaning products and do not use products containing ammonia or bleach. • Check fasteners after each season to ensure that they are not loose or dislodged.
